Transaction 666cfcf747797e0852592248e077cd906fdbf9641e17ab563fd648aafbfa2645

1 Input
2 Outputs
  • 666cfcf747797e0852592248e077cd906fdbf9641e17ab563fd648aafbfa2645:0
  • value  32198730
    address  3LQSDbBw2uYfjuAUCTBghg3Vs5P73ggZ1t
  • 666cfcf747797e0852592248e077cd906fdbf9641e17ab563fd648aafbfa2645:1
  • value  588622
    address  3CYmci5f3ibsT6bBfiS3HyA3PqdxymMp6i